36#ifndef _HR_VAR_H
37#define _HR_VAR_H
38
39#include <adt/list.h>
40#include <bd_srv.h>
41#include <errno.h>
42#include <fibril_synch.h>
43#include <hr.h>
44#include <stdatomic.h>
45
46#include "fge.h"
47#include "superblock.h"
48
49#define NAME "hr"
50#define HR_STRIP_SIZE DATA_XFER_LIMIT
51
52struct hr_volume;
53typedef struct hr_volume hr_volume_t;
54typedef struct hr_metadata hr_metadata_t;
55typedef struct hr_superblock_ops hr_superblock_ops_t;
56
57typedef struct hr_ops {
58 errno_t (*create)(hr_volume_t *);
59 errno_t (*init)(hr_volume_t *);
60 void (*status_event)(hr_volume_t *);
61 errno_t (*add_hotspare)(hr_volume_t *, service_id_t);
62} hr_ops_t;
63
64typedef struct hr_volume {
65 link_t lvolumes; /* link to all volumes list */
66 hr_ops_t hr_ops; /* level init and create fcns */
67 bd_srvs_t hr_bds; /* block interface to the vol */
68 service_id_t svc_id; /* service id */
69
70 fibril_mutex_t lock; /* XXX: gone after para */
71 list_t range_lock_list; /* list of range locks */
72 fibril_mutex_t range_lock_list_lock; /* range locks list lock */
73 hr_fpool_t *fge; /* fibril pool */
74
75 void *in_mem_md;
76 fibril_mutex_t md_lock; /* lock protecting in_mem_md */
77
78 hr_superblock_ops_t *meta_ops;
79
80 /* invariants */
81 size_t extent_no; /* number of extents */
82 size_t bsize; /* block size */
83 uint64_t truncated_blkno; /* blkno per extent */
84 uint64_t data_blkno; /* no. of user usable blocks */
85 uint64_t data_offset; /* user data offset in blocks */
86 uint32_t strip_size; /* strip size */
87 hr_level_t level; /* volume level */
88 uint8_t layout; /* RAID Level Qualifier */
89 char devname[HR_DEVNAME_LEN];
90
91 hr_extent_t extents[HR_MAX_EXTENTS];
92 fibril_rwlock_t extents_lock; /* extent service id lock */
93
94 size_t hotspare_no; /* no. of available hotspares */
95 hr_extent_t hotspares[HR_MAX_HOTSPARES];
96 fibril_mutex_t hotspare_lock; /* lock protecting hotspares */
97
98 fibril_rwlock_t states_lock; /* states lock */
99
100 _Atomic bool state_dirty; /* dirty state */
101
102 /* XXX: atomic_uint_least64_t? */
103 _Atomic uint64_t rebuild_blk; /* rebuild position */
104 _Atomic int open_cnt; /* open/close() counter */
105 hr_vol_status_t status; /* volume status */
106 void (*state_callback)(hr_volume_t *, size_t, errno_t);
107} hr_volume_t;
108
109typedef enum {
110 HR_BD_SYNC,
111 HR_BD_READ,
112 HR_BD_WRITE
113} hr_bd_op_type_t;
114
115/* macros for hr_metadata_save() */
116#define WITH_STATE_CALLBACK true
117#define NO_STATE_CALLBACK false
118
119typedef struct hr_range_lock {
120 link_t link;
121 fibril_mutex_t lock;
122 hr_volume_t *vol; /* back-pointer to volume */
123 uint64_t off; /* start of the range */
124 uint64_t len; /* length of the range */
125
126 size_t pending; /* prot. by vol->range_lock_list_lock */
127 bool ignore; /* prot. by vol->range_lock_list_lock */
128} hr_range_lock_t;
129
130extern errno_t hr_raid0_create(hr_volume_t *);
131extern errno_t hr_raid1_create(hr_volume_t *);
132extern errno_t hr_raid5_create(hr_volume_t *);
133
134extern errno_t hr_raid0_init(hr_volume_t *);
135extern errno_t hr_raid1_init(hr_volume_t *);
136extern errno_t hr_raid5_init(hr_volume_t *);
137
138extern void hr_raid0_status_event(hr_volume_t *);
139extern void hr_raid1_status_event(hr_volume_t *);
140extern void hr_raid5_status_event(hr_volume_t *);
141
142extern errno_t hr_raid1_add_hotspare(hr_volume_t *, service_id_t);
143extern errno_t hr_raid5_add_hotspare(hr_volume_t *, service_id_t);
144
145#endif
